P0045 Code

Advertisement

p0045 code: Understanding Its Meaning, Causes, and Solutions

If you've recently plugged in your scan tool and discovered the p0045 code, you're likely wondering what this code signifies and how to address it. The p0045 code is a common diagnostic trouble code (DTC) that relates to your vehicle’s emissions control system, specifically involving the exhaust gas recirculation (EGR) system. In this article, we will explore the meaning of the p0045 code, its causes, symptoms, diagnostic process, and potential fixes to help you get your vehicle back on the road smoothly.

---

What Does the P0045 Code Mean?



The p0045 code is a generic powertrain code indicating an issue with the Exhaust Gas Recirculation (EGR) system, specifically related to the "EGR Heater Control Circuit." This code is set when the Engine Control Module (ECM) detects a malfunction or an abnormal reading in the EGR heater circuit, which is responsible for controlling the temperature of the EGR system.

Understanding the EGR System and P0045:

- The EGR system reduces nitrogen oxide (NOx) emissions by recirculating a portion of exhaust gases back into the engine's intake manifold.
- The EGR heater is used in some vehicles, especially in colder climates, to heat the EGR gases to improve emissions control during cold starts.
- The p0045 code indicates a problem with the EGR heater control circuit, such as an open circuit, short, or malfunctioning heater.

---

Causes of the P0045 Code



Several issues can trigger the p0045 code. Understanding these causes can help in diagnosing and resolving the problem effectively.

Common Causes Include:




  • Faulty EGR Heater or Heating Element: The heater itself may be burned out or damaged, preventing proper operation.

  • Damaged Wiring or Connectors: Corrosion, frayed wires, or loose connections in the EGR heater circuit can lead to electrical faults.

  • Blown Fuse: The fuse protecting the EGR heater circuit may be blown, cutting power to the heater.

  • Malfunctioning EGR Valve or Sensor: Issues with the EGR valve or its sensors can cause incorrect readings and trigger the code.

  • Faulty Engine Control Module (ECM): In rare cases, the ECM itself may be malfunctioning or providing incorrect signals.

  • Cold Weather Conditions: Extremely cold environments may affect the heater's performance or sensors, leading to the code being set.



---

Symptoms of the P0045 Code



Recognizing the symptoms associated with the p0045 code can help you determine when to seek professional diagnosis and repair.

Common Symptoms Include:




  • Check Engine Light is On: The most obvious indicator is the illumination of the Check Engine or Malfunction Indicator Light (MIL).

  • Rough Idling or Engine Hesitation: Due to improper EGR operation, the engine may idle roughly or hesitate during acceleration.

  • Reduced Fuel Efficiency: Malfunctions in the EGR system can lead to increased fuel consumption.

  • Increased Emissions: The vehicle may emit higher levels of NOx or other pollutants.

  • Difficulty Starting in Cold Weather: Since the issue involves the heater system, starting problems may occur in colder climates.



---

Diagnosing the P0045 Code



Proper diagnosis of the p0045 code involves a systematic approach to identify the root cause accurately.

Tools Needed:




  • OBD-II scanner

  • Multimeter

  • Service manual for specific vehicle

  • Test light



Diagnostic Steps:




  1. Confirm the Code: Use an OBD-II scanner to verify the presence of the p0045 code and check for any additional codes that may be related.

  2. Inspect Wiring and Connectors: Visually examine the wiring harness connected to the EGR heater for damage, corrosion, or loose connections.

  3. Check the Fuse: Locate and inspect the fuse related to the EGR heater circuit; replace if blown.

  4. Test the EGR Heater: Use a multimeter to check the resistance of the heater element; compare readings to manufacturer specifications.

  5. Inspect the EGR Valve and Sensors: Ensure the EGR valve operates freely and sensors are functioning correctly.

  6. Check Power and Ground Circuits: Use a test light or multimeter to verify voltage supply and proper grounding.

  7. Replace Faulty Components: Based on findings, replace damaged wiring, blown fuse, or the EGR heater as necessary.

  8. Clear Codes and Test Drive: After repairs, clear the codes and operate the vehicle to see if the code returns.



---

Potential Repairs for the P0045 Code



Once diagnosed, repairs can vary depending on the specific cause. Here are common fixes for the p0045 code.

Repair Options:




  1. Replace the EGR Heater: If the heater element is damaged or burnt out, installing a new heater is necessary.

  2. Fix Wiring and Connectors: Repair or replace any damaged wires or corroded connectors in the circuit.

  3. Replace Blown Fuse: Insert a new fuse of the correct amperage to restore power to the heater circuit.

  4. Replace the EGR Valve or Sensors: If the valve or sensor is faulty, replace with OEM parts for optimal performance.

  5. Update or Reprogram ECM: In rare cases, a software update or reprogramming of the ECM may be required.



Note: Always follow the specific repair procedures outlined in your vehicle's service manual, and if unsure, consult a professional mechanic.

---

Preventive Measures and Tips



Prevention can save you time and money in the long run. Here are some tips to avoid future issues related to the p0045 code:


  • Regular Maintenance: Follow your vehicle’s recommended maintenance schedule, including inspection of emissions components.

  • Use Quality Fuel and Additives: This can help reduce carbon buildup and keep the EGR system functioning properly.

  • Address Cold Weather Issues Promptly: In colder climates, ensure that the EGR heater and related components are in good condition to prevent cold starts from triggering faults.

  • Keep Wiring Inspections Routine: Periodically check wiring harnesses and connectors for signs of wear or corrosion.



---

When to Seek Professional Help



While some DIY enthusiasts with automotive repair experience can handle minor fixes, the p0045 code may require specialized diagnostic tools and technical expertise.

Consult a professional if:

- You lack experience with electrical diagnostics.
- The problem persists after basic repairs.
- You're unsure about testing procedures.
- The vehicle exhibits severe or persistent symptoms.

A certified mechanic can accurately diagnose the root cause and ensure proper repair, preventing further damage or emissions issues.

---

Conclusion



The p0045 code is an indication of a problem within the EGR heater control circuit, often related to electrical issues, faulty components, or wiring problems. Recognizing the causes, symptoms, and diagnostic steps is crucial to resolving the problem effectively. Whether it’s replacing a broken heater element, repairing wiring, or addressing related sensor issues, prompt attention to the p0045 code can improve your vehicle’s emissions performance, fuel efficiency, and overall reliability.

Remember, always refer to your vehicle’s service manual for specific diagnostic procedures and specifications. If you're unsure or uncomfortable performing repairs yourself, seek assistance from a qualified automotive technician to ensure the problem is resolved correctly and safely.

Frequently Asked Questions


What does the P0045 code mean?

The P0045 code indicates a malfunction in the turbocharger boost control position sensor circuit, typically related to the boost control solenoid or its wiring.

What are common causes of the P0045 code?

Common causes include a faulty boost control solenoid, damaged wiring or connectors, a defective turbocharger, or issues with the engine control module (ECM).

How can I troubleshoot the P0045 code?

Start by inspecting the boost control solenoid and its wiring for damage or corrosion, then test the solenoid's operation, and check for any vacuum leaks or turbocharger issues. A scan tool can also help monitor sensor readings.

Can the P0045 code be cleared without fixing the problem?

While clearing the code may temporarily turn off the warning light, the underlying issue will remain, potentially causing engine performance problems or damage. It's recommended to diagnose and repair the root cause.

Is the P0045 code serious, and should I drive my vehicle with it?

Yes, the P0045 code can affect engine performance and may lead to further damage if not addressed promptly. It's best to have your vehicle inspected by a professional as soon as possible.

How much does it typically cost to repair a P0045 code issue?

Repair costs vary depending on the exact cause; replacing a boost control solenoid can cost between $150 and $300, including parts and labor. More extensive repairs, like wiring or turbocharger issues, may increase costs.